Transaction 64badd9497e9de50d42bd9223219d3c8f3eb8a78081e495c709b66714efcb79c

1 Input
2 Outputs
  • 64badd9497e9de50d42bd9223219d3c8f3eb8a78081e495c709b66714efcb79c:0
  • value  500000000
    address  36nUFFzfD8VFbiEksoizmmDZ9XEjovVpmj
  • 64badd9497e9de50d42bd9223219d3c8f3eb8a78081e495c709b66714efcb79c:1
  • value  15596165
    address  1B7htMvtEhf56mRcG4sc2KE1ozVr6hd95t